Digital and analogue, equally at home
What sets the 9000A apart from competitors in its class is the seamless marriage of serious digital capability with genuine analogue credentials. Four digital inputs handle hi-res PCM up to 24-bit/192kHz, supported by the flagship ESS ES9038PRO 32-bit DAC, a chip widely regarded as one of the finest available, featuring HyperStream® II architecture and Time Domain Jitter Eliminator for vanishingly low jitter and noise.
Audiolab's long experience with ESS technology means the 9000A isn't simply dropping in a premium chip and hoping for the best. Years of refinement in DAC implementation, filter voicing and circuit topology result in performance that genuinely reflects the ES9038PRO's capabilities.
PCM playback extends to 32-bit/768kHz, with DSD support up to DSD512 (22.5MHz). All major lossless and hi-res formats are supported, FLAC, ALAC, AIFF, WAV, alongside legacy compressed formats for complete source compatibility.
On the analogue side, three AUX inputs, a balanced XLR input and a dedicated phono stage ensure that traditional source equipment is equally well served.
Full MQA decoding
The 9000A delivers complete three-stage MQA unfolding internally, rather than acting solely as a renderer for the final unfold. For subscribers to Tidal's HiFi Plus tier accessing Masters content, this means the full MQA experience is handled within the amplifier itself, no additional hardware required.

Serious power, seriously applied
The discrete Class AB power stage delivers a genuine 100W per channel into 8 ohms, rising to 160W into 4 ohms. These are real-world figures, not marketing numbers, placing the 9000A firmly in contention with the best amplifiers in its price bracket. A custom 320VA toroidal transformer and 60,000μF of total reservoir capacitance (four 15,000μF capacitors) give the power supply the reserves to handle dynamic peaks without flinching.
The CFB (Complementary Feedback) topology, long a cornerstone of audiolab's amplifier design, maintains superior linearity and thermal stability by keeping idle current independent of output transistor temperature. The result is consistent, controlled performance across extended listening sessions.
Signal integrity through the preamp section is preserved by keeping the circuit path as direct and uncluttered as possible, a design discipline that has defined Jan Ertner's work across decades of audiolab products.
Phono stage
The built-in phono stage continues audiolab's tradition of raising the bar with each successive generation. The 9000A's moving magnet phono input uses a JFET-based circuit with precise RIAA equalisation, a meaningful upgrade for turntable users who'd rather not invest in a separate phono stage.
Headphone output
Current-feedback circuitry with wide bandwidth and high slew rate underpins the headphone output, delivering a dynamic and detailed performance across a wide range of headphone impedances and sensitivities.
Three operating modes
The 9000A offers three system integration modes. In standard Integrated mode, pre and power stages work together for direct source-to-speaker use. Pre-Power mode separates the stages, allowing the 9000A to function as a standalone power amplifier, useful in home cinema configurations where an AV processor handles signal routing, or to accommodate external processing in the signal chain while retaining the benefit of the 9000A's amplification and pre-section performance.
